OBJECTIVES: The prognostic value of MMP-9 and TGF-β1 in oral squamous cell carcinoma (OSCC) is not clear. This study aimed to assess this subject. METHODS: After immunohistochemistry staining of 48 OSCC biopsies with MMP-9 and TGF-β1 markers, marker expression in the stroma was estimated, and the correlations with OSCC prognosis determinants were analyzed (α = 0.05). RESULTS: Mode of invasion was associated with metastasis (rho = 0.449, p = 0.008). MMP-9 was positively associated with metastasis and mode of invasion. TGF-β1 was negatively correlated to tumor histologic grade but was positively associated with metastasis. CONCLUSIONS: Unlike TGF-β1, MMP-9 might be useful for prognosis determination.
